#1d6ec8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d6ec8 is composed of 11.4% red, 43.1%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.5% cyan, 45%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 211.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.7% and a lightness of 44.9%. #1d6ec8 color hex could be obtained by blending #3adcff with #000091.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#1d6ec8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d6ec8 has RGB values of R:29, G:110,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 1928904.

Shades and Tints of #1d6ec8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02060c is the darkest color, while #f9fc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1d6ec8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c7279 is the less saturated color, while #036de2 is the most saturated one.
